Decoding Complexity with Sankey Charts: A Visual Guide to Flow Analysis and Data Storytelling
Sankey Chart, an innovative and visually striking graphical representation, provides a detailed insight into the pathways of data flow. This guide aims to illuminate the potential of Sankey diagrams in enhancing our comprehension of complex datasets and narrating meaningful stories within the data. From elucidating intricate supply chains to illustrating energy transitions, Sankey charts offer an unparalleled perspective in data visualization.
### Introduction to Sankey Diagrams
**Definition:** Sankey diagrams are a type of flow diagram where the width of the arrows is proportional to the flow magnitude. Key elements include nodes, which represent distinct categories, and links, which represent the flow between these categories, such as movement of energy, people, or data.
**Uses:** These diagrams are particularly advantageous in visualizing multi-step processes where materials, energy, money, or values move through different nodes. They are invaluable in fields ranging from economics to ecology, where understanding the flow and distribution of resources, or information, is critical.
### Elements of a Sankey Diagram
**Nodes:** These represent the entities or categories in the flow network, such as sources and destinations. Nodes can be static or dynamic, depending on the context of the diagram.
**Links:** These are the connections between nodes, visually indicating the direction and magnitude of data flow. The width of the link signifies the volume or intensity of the flow. The color of the links is often used to distinguish between different types of flows.
**Flow Visualization:** The key to a well-composed Sankey diagram is the effective visualization of the flow’s magnitude. This is achieved by varying the thickness of the arrows in accordance with the data flow values.
### Advantages of Sankey Diagrams
**Clarity:** They provide a clear and intuitive way to visualize data flow, making it easier for stakeholders to comprehend complex data structures at a glance.
**Storytelling Value:** By depicting data flows as a story of connected nodes and paths, Sankey diagrams aid in narrating stories about data movement, highlighting significant flows or bottlenecks in the data.
**Comparative Analysis:** Sankey diagrams excel in comparing different sets of flows, allowing for the identification of significant variations or patterns between different stages or components.
### Best Practices for Creating Effective Sankey Diagrams
1. **Define Clear Objectives:** Establish what you want to communicate and ensure your chart aligns with this goal. This guides the simplification of complex data, focusing on the most relevant aspects.
2. **Use Color Wisely:** Employ color differentiation to enhance readability and add layers of information. Use distinct colors for different flow types or to signify changes in composition or magnitude.
3. **Maintain Readability:** Optimize node labels and arrow widths for clarity. Avoid overcrowding the display, as this can make understanding less intuitive.
4. **Choose Appropriate Software:** Utilize data visualization tools that support Sankey diagrams. Popular choices include Tableau, Microsoft Power BI, and Sankey visualization libraries for web applications such as d3.js.
### Conclusion
Sankey diagrams offer a unique approach to data visualization, making them a powerful tool in the arsenal of data analysts and visual storytellers. By effectively mapping and narrating complex data flows, they facilitate a deeper understanding and communication of intricate data patterns across multiple fields. Whether aiming to streamline supply chains, explore energy conservation, or uncover trends in financial transactions, Sankey diagrams illuminate the pathways in data analysis, turning complexity into clarity through their sophisticated visual stories.
